They are basically tiny cabbages! All brassicas (cruciferous vegetables), so kale, cabbage, broccoli, pak choi, mustard, brussel sprouts, cauliflower, kohlrabi, etc. are really good for you. (Don't eat too many cruciferous veg (eg a cabbage a day would be 'too many!') though if you have thyroid issues, but don't cut them out completely.)

Brussels sprouts are a source of the B-vitamins necessary for cellular energy production, including vitamin B6, thiamine, and folate. Brussels sprouts contain 24% of the daily recommended amount of vitamin A, which is important for eyes and immunity. Brussels sprouts are an excellent source of …Fiber also helps feed the beneficial bacteria in the gut that promote overall health. If you are looking to increase your fiber intake, raw Brussels sprouts are a better option for you. They have 3.8 grams of fiber per 100 grams, while cooked Brussels sprouts provide 2.6 grams of fiber. 1. Vitamin K. Brussels sprouts are a very good source of Vitamin K, which helps with blood clotting. This is useful if you suffer a cut or graze, as it means the wound will heal faster. Studies have shown that Vitamin K can also contribute to strong bones and protect you against osteoporosis.

One study found a 10x increase in antioxidants like rutin from only ...Here are some of the other reasons why sprouts are good for your immune system: When grains are soaked, there is a decrease in their tannin and phytic acid content. Thus, sprouts allow better nutrient absorption into the body. The sprouting process itself enhances the vitamins and minerals present in the un-sprouted plants.

7) Sprouted Foods Cook Faster. Because the sprouting process partially digests some of the starches in the grain or legume, it can help reduce the cooking time of of your rice or beans when you're in a pinch! This vitamin is critical to healthy bone growth, proper blood clotting, and many other bodily …Dec 19, 2022 · When choosing sprouts, look for ones that are firm and firmly attached to their stems. The leaves should be a rich green. The stems should be white in color. The container should not be moist or smelly, and the sprouts should not look slimy.
